In most operating coalcleaning plants, a significant amount of pyrite is recovered in the froth during flotation of highsulfur coal. Reducing the pyrite recovery first requires that the primary recovery mechanism should be identified, as different measures are required for reducing entrainment, lockedparticle flotation, or true hydrophobic flotation.

The application of cyclonic microbubble flotation column (FCMC) from laboratory to industrial scale was investigated in this study. The FCMC was found to be superior to the standard selfaeration flotation cell for separating the fine coal (below mm in size) as sampled from the Xiezhuang coal preparation plant (CPP), and tested under laboratory conditions.

Results show that FCMC flotation column is especially suitable for the beneficiation of fine and nonselective coal slime downstream the heavy medium separation. The mixed (onestage) flotation process utilizing the combination of flotation column and clean coal quickoperating pressure filter is recommended in newly built and retrofitted CPPs.

Jan 01, 2013· Column flotation is the most efficient technology currently available that can selectively remove high ash content slime material from the ultrafine coal. As such, column flotation is effective in producing clean coal concentrates containing ultralow (, < 3%) ash content when the ashbearing minerals are completely liberated from the coal.

Much of the lower efficiency of fine coal cleaning is due to poor size separation of the finesized raw coal which results in misplaced high ash fines reporting to the coarser size streams. By sending coarser material to column flotation, the finest size separation that takes place in a plant can be as coarse as mm or greater.

Coal flotation is commonly carried out with a combination of an oily collector ( fuel oil) and a frother ( MIBC). All coal flotation systems require the addition of a frother to generate small bubbles and to create a stable froth (Table ).
